Core Insights - The Saudi Public Investment Fund (PIF) is set to acquire a controlling 93.4% stake in Electronic Arts (EA) for $55 billion, marking a significant shift from traditional leveraged buyouts to sovereign wealth funds acting as strategic stakeholders [1][2][3] Group 1: Ownership Structure - PIF will invest approximately $29 billion in new funds, alongside its existing 9.9% stake valued at about $5.2 billion, aligning its total investment with its final ownership percentage [2][10] - Silver Lake and Affinity Partners will hold minor stakes of 5.5% and 1.1%, respectively, indicating a shift in the typical leveraged buyout model where private equity leads and sovereign funds follow [2][10] - PIF's role as a significant investor in both Silver Lake and Affinity Partners creates a "capital nesting" structure, enhancing its control but exposing it to multiple layers of risk [2][10] Group 2: Strategic Implications for Saudi Arabia - The acquisition is a key move in Saudi Arabia's Vision 2030 economic diversification strategy, aiming to position gaming as a core industry in a post-oil economy [3][11] - The investment aligns with Saudi Arabia's goals to enhance its soft power through events like the 2034 World Cup, leveraging EA's popular franchises [3][11] - Despite the strategic intent, the deal comes amid increasing fiscal pressures, with a projected budget deficit of 5.3% of GDP in 2025, the highest since the pandemic [3][11] Group 3: EA's Challenges and Transformation - EA's acceptance of the acquisition stems from growth stagnation and market pressures, with revenues hovering between $7.4 billion and $7.6 billion over the past three fiscal years, and a 1.31% decline expected in FY2025 [4][12] - The company faces a significant debt burden of $20 billion post-privatization, far exceeding its previous $2.2 billion debt, with annual interest payments potentially exceeding $1 billion [4][12] - Historical precedents suggest that high-leverage buyouts often lead to layoffs and cost-cutting measures, raising concerns about potential restructuring within EA's studios [4][12] Group 4: Industry Dynamics and Creative Autonomy - EA's situation reflects a broader trend of consolidation in the gaming industry, moving from product competition to capital competition, especially following Microsoft's $69 billion acquisition of Activision Blizzard [5][14] - Balancing capital empowerment with creative autonomy poses a significant challenge, as PIF's national strategic interests may influence EA's creative decisions [5][14] - PIF has committed to retaining EA's current management, but concerns remain about potential biases in game development, particularly regarding the "FC" series and its ties to Saudi investments [5][14] Group 5: Future Outlook and Risks - PIF plans to integrate AI technology into EA's operations to enhance efficiency, though the implications for creative uniqueness remain uncertain [6][15] - Geopolitical risks are significant, with potential scrutiny from the U.S. Committee on Foreign Investment due to PIF's control over a U.S. cultural enterprise [6][15] - The outcome of this acquisition will serve as a litmus test for sovereign capital's ability to operate globally in high-tech cultural assets, with implications for the future of the gaming industry [8][16]

Group 1: Production Capacity and Upgrades - The company currently has an annual production capacity of approximately 1.25 million tons of glass fiber yarn. A project to upgrade and enhance the electronic-grade glass fiber production line with a capacity of 85,000 tons is expected to be completed within the year, further improving cost competitiveness in the electronic yarn segment [1]. - The company will focus on upgrading old production capacities and adjusting product structures and capacities according to market supply and demand to meet customer needs [2]. Group 2: Foreign Exchange Risk Management - The company has established a systematic foreign exchange risk management framework, prioritizing "natural hedging" from the business side by optimizing the business structure to balance foreign currency purchases and sales [3]. - For residual exposures that cannot be naturally hedged, the company employs financial instruments for targeted management, including asset-liability matching and key transaction hedging strategies [3]. Group 3: Trade and Anti-Dumping Strategies - To address international trade friction and anti-dumping risks, the company has developed a systematic response strategy, including diversifying markets and localizing operations to reduce dependence on a single market [4][5]. - The company emphasizes technological innovation and focuses on high-performance, high-value-added products to strengthen its market position [5]. Group 4: Wind Power Market Outlook - The company holds a core supplier position in the wind power materials sector, particularly in high-modulus and ultra-high-modulus products, with strong technical advantages and customer base [6]. - The Chinese government has set a target of adding no less than 120 million kilowatts of wind power capacity during the 14th Five-Year Plan, providing solid policy guidance and market space for the industry [6]. Group 5: Overseas Operations and Risk Management - The company has established a systematic risk management framework to enhance the operational resilience of its overseas bases in Brazil and Bahrain, which are currently running smoothly [7]. - The Brazilian subsidiary experienced temporary losses in 2024 due to production line maintenance and currency depreciation, but operational conditions have gradually improved since 2025 [7]. Group 6: Low Dielectric Electronic Yarn - The company has been engaged in the research and production of low-dielectric glass fiber products for 5G applications, gaining a first-mover advantage through proactive R&D investments [9]. - The demand for low-dielectric glass fiber is increasing due to the expansion of AI technology applications, with the company continuously optimizing product performance and production processes to meet market demands [9].

12月8日,歌力思(603808.SH)召开2025年第三季度业绩说明会。2025年前三季度,公司归母净利润 同比增长427.34%至1.14亿元,受到了市场的高度关注。 歌力思在业绩说明会上指出,利润的大幅改善离不开多方面的协同发力。一方面,公司旗下多品牌在国 内市场稳健发展,获得了稳步增长;另一方面,国内经营管理效率提升,费用率有所下降;同时,公司 通过加速优化低效门店、加强预算管理,费用进一步控制,海外业务逐步改善。 有投资者关注到,歌力思旗下收购的多个品牌近年表现亮眼。公司表示,核心原因在于公司坚守"成为 有国际竞争力的高端时装品牌集团"的战略目标,聚焦高端时装领域持续耕耘。公司持续强化设计、加 大品牌投入与终端运营管理,深挖品牌内涵以提升品牌力、推动门店升级,强调会员体验优化,还通过 线上多品牌多平台的发展策略,充分挖掘不同品牌的增长潜力,推动线上业务快速发展,精细化运营管 理能力成为品牌发展的根本支撑。 费用率的下降是公司业绩改善的重要助力。2025年被定位为公司的"降本年",公司通过持续推进流程优 化、严格预算管理,让各品牌全面强调营销活动品销合一,同时从"设计-供应链-商品管理-品牌运营"全 ...
